    Abstract: An object is to improve a trap effect to trap ignition fuel gas supplied to a pre-combustion chamber and reduce an amount of non-combusted ignition fuel gas flowing out of the pre-combustion chamber to suppress a decrease in combustion efficiency. A pre-combustion-chamber type gas engine includes: a pre-combustion chamber Sr disposed on a cylinder head portion 10; a spark plug 20 disposed on an upper part of the pre-combustion chamber Sr; a pre-combustion-chamber gas supply mechanism configured to supply ignition fuel gas ā€œgā€ to the pre-combustion chamber Sr via gas supply channels for the pre-combustion chamber 22a and 22b with an opening on an upper part of the pre-combustion chamber Sr; and a check valve 24 disposed in the gas supply channel 22b for the pre-combustion chamber.

    Abstract: A cylinder head of a stationary gas engine is provided with a cylinder internal pressure sensor. An engine frame is provided with an instrumentation device installation device. An amplifier for amplifying a signal detected by the cylinder internal pressure sensor is fixed to the instrumentation device installation device. The instrumentation device installation device includes a suspending tool formed of a fixing plate which is in contact with a horizontal plane and is fixed thereto by bolts, an extension plate bent at a right angle to the fixing plate, and a suspending plate bent at a right angle to the extension plate and arranged in parallel with the fixing plate, and a coil spring connected at one end thereof to the suspending plate, and connected at the other end thereof to a fixing band for holding the amplifier.

    Abstract: A cylinder head includes a cylinder head body provided with intake and exhaust ports opened toward a combustion chamber and capable of being closed by valves, the intake and exhaust ports being separated from each other in a circumferential direction around a cylinder central axis. An opening section of at least one of the intake or exhaust ports facing the combustion chamber is provided with a seat surface centered on a valve axis and a tapered surface is disposed closer to the combustion chamber than the seat surface, the tapered surface gradually increasing in diameter closer to the combustion chamber. A central axis of the tapered surface is disposed eccentrically from the valve axis toward the cylinder central axis.

    Abstract: A control device of a premix combustion engine includes a hybrid turbocharger including a turbocharger having a compressor and a turbine, and a motor generator coupled with the compressor. A control unit controls the motor generator based on the operating conditions regarding a generator or the premix combustion engine and includes: an airflow rate computing unit for computing the necessary airflow rate required for the premix combustion engine, and an arithmetic unit for computing the power output or the rotation speed regarding the hybrid turbocharger to obtain the necessary airflow rate required for the premix combustion engine. Feedback control regarding the power output or the rotation speed as to the hybrid turbocharger is performed based on the computed results obtained by the arithmetic unit.

    Abstract: In an auxiliary chamber gas supplying device for a gas engine including an auxiliary chamber gas supply path through which fuel gas is supplied to an auxiliary chamber, the auxiliary chamber gas supply path is connected to a fuel gas supply source through a solenoid valve, and when the solenoid valve is opened, the fuel gas, in an amount corresponding to an opened period of the solenoid valve, is supplied from the fuel gas supply source to the auxiliary chamber through the auxiliary chamber gas supply path, and the opened period of the solenoid valve is set in such a manner that a predetermined amount of fuel gas is supplied to the auxiliary chamber, and a restriction unit that extends the opened period of the solenoid valve is formed in the auxiliary chamber gas supply path.
